当前位置: 首页 > news >正文

dedecms蓝色企业网站模板企业电脑管理软件

dedecms蓝色企业网站模板,企业电脑管理软件,宜宾网站设计,东莞长安网站制作文章地址 https://blog.csdn.net/qq_43618881/article/details/118657040 连接器 请求先走到连接器,与客户端建立连接、获取权限、维持和管理连接 mysql缓存池 如果要查找的数据直接在mysql缓存池里面就直接返回数据 分析器 请求已经建立了连接,现在…

文章地址

https://blog.csdn.net/qq_43618881/article/details/118657040

连接器

请求先走到连接器,与客户端建立连接、获取权限、维持和管理连接

mysql缓存池

如果要查找的数据直接在mysql缓存池里面就直接返回数据

分析器

请求已经建立了连接,现在需要对请求的语法进行分析,生成一个语法树

如果语法不对在这里直接报错

优化器

在这里对你写的sql进行优化

比如说表连接查询的时候小表 left join 大表

最后生成执行计划

也就是explain出来的结果

执行器

随后将执行计划交给执行引擎进行操作,比如innodb存储引擎,mysql的存储引擎支持插件化

执行引擎

INNODB存储引擎,会对执行计划进行处理

INNODB缓存池

在INNODB里面也有缓存池,里面会有各种各样的脏页

INNODB流程

select

首先查看数据是否在缓存池当中,如果是的话直接对数据进行返回

如果不在缓存池当中从磁盘读取root 的下面的非聚簇索引页,根据slot,进行二分查找,最后按照偏移量找到对应的页表,如果下一个节点还是非聚簇节点,就重复这个步骤,如果不是非聚簇节点,就查找真正的数据

slot槽

slot槽在页头中,每个页都是有的

slot 记录了每一个页的偏移量,是一个数组的结构,可以支持二分查找

先从 B+Tree 的根开始,逐层检索,直到找到叶子节点,也就是找到对应的数据页为止,然后将数据页加载到内存中,页目录中的槽(slot)采用二分查找的方式先找到一个粗略的记录分组,最后在分组中通过链表遍历的方式查找到记录。

insert

先记录undo日志

修改buffer pool中的数据

        使用double write buffer 两次写进行持久化

        写redo log 

                redo log 根据设置的频率进行刷盘

                记录binlog

http://www.yayakq.cn/news/54271/

相关文章:

  • 淘宝客网站名游戏网站后台建设
  • 俄语网站建设公司代理产品
  • 网站开发商品管理表字段网站怎么开发设计
  • 天门市电子商务网站建设有哪些做副业的网站
  • 馨雨公司网站建设策划方案品牌标志设计的风格包括
  • 旅游电商网站排名ps和dw 做网站
  • 用什么技术来做网站网站建设零基础教学
  • 网页制作素材网站手机数码网站
  • 销型网站建设必须的步骤包括深圳宝安固戍小学网站建设
  • 长春火车站时刻表网片钢筋
  • 微网站自己怎么做的吗承德网站建设步骤
  • 中明建投建设集团 网站辽宁省建设工程信息招标网
  • 网站登录和权限怎么做深圳seo网络推广公司
  • 上海哪个网站能应聘做家教的软件外包网站
  • 网站建设公司汕头的局域网内网站建设的步骤过程
  • wordpress网站域名服务器020网站开发
  • 滨江建设交易门户网站如何制作购物网页
  • 湖北长安建设网站qq钓鱼网站怎么制作
  • 网站建设记账深圳人才一体化综合服务平台
  • 顺德龙江做网站江苏质量员证在哪个网站做的
  • 汽车之家如何做团购网站logo网站在线制作
  • 163建筑网站建设网站的机构
  • 淘宝网站代理怎么做的seo优化或网站编辑
  • 免费企业网站cmswordpress 首页调用页面标题
  • 出名的建站网站电子商务适合女生学吗
  • 大连网站开发培训班海沧网站建设
  • 深圳专门网站制作前端和后端哪个好学
  • 北京电商平台网站建设wordpress为什么好卡
  • 简述网站建设基本步骤武夷山网站设计
  • 行业网站建设报价下列关于网站开发中